Output 4e138322730665df57580c3a1366060f84d6474304e3c84b2a039f9c0a583bde:1

value
1349062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b09f8ac3067b8ddbdf740a56f8b2b9f0a254528 OP_EQUAL
address
3QaPUWvDg58UBuni4pGNRiMZJqJbMxtkoT
transaction
4e138322730665df57580c3a1366060f84d6474304e3c84b2a039f9c0a583bde
spent
true